The Alexa Smart Home team is focused on making Alexa the user interface for the home. Customers love using Alexa to interact with their homes through natural commands and intuitive interfaces. We are evolving Alexa into an intelligent, indispensable companion that helps customers get the most out of the technology in their homes.

 

The Alexa Smart Home Team is seeking a software development engineer to help develop new solutions focused on improving the quality, diversity, and customer experience of smart home devices.

 

The ideal teammate is passionate about Alexa and has a track record of success in delivering new features and products. A commitment to teamwork, knowledge of IoT systems, strong CS fundamentals, experience developing new systems, and strong communication skills (to both business and technical partners) are absolute requirements.

 

As a leader on the team, you will be responsible for leading the development and launch of core product features. You will have significant influence on our overall strategy by helping define these product features, system design, and best practices.

 

Key Job Responsibilities:

  • Leading development and maintenance of key system features
  • Working with other team members to investigate design approaches
  • Prototyping designs and testing them with teammates
  • Working in an Agile/Scrum environment to deliver high quality software against tight schedules.

It’s Always Day 1
At Amazon, it’s always “Day 1.” Now, what does this mean and why does it matter? It means that our approach remains the same as it was on Amazon’s very first day – to make smart, fast decisions, stay nimble, invent, and stay focused on delighting our customers. In our 2016 shareholder letter, Amazon CEO Jeff Bezos shared his thoughts on how to keep up a Day 1 company mindset. “Staying in Day 1 requires you to experiment patiently, accept failures, plant seeds, protect saplings, and double down when you see customer delight,” he wrote. “A customer-obsessed culture best creates the conditions where all of that can happen.” You can read the full letter here
